PLYMOUTH CITY COUNCIL
THE CITY OF PLYMOUTH
(LORRIMORE AVENUE/ST GEORGES TERRACE/ ST LEVAN ROAD/STURDEE ROAD/FISHER ROAD/GANGES ROAD/GLENMORE AVENUE/ CRAIGMORE AVENUE/WELSFORD AVENUE/ BALMORAL AVENUE) (TEMPORARY PROHIBITION OF DRIVING, PARKING, WAITING, LOADING,UNOADING) ORDER 2026
NOTICE is hereby given that Plymouth City Council acting under section 14(1) of the Road Traffic Regulation Act 1984 (as amended), intend to make an Order the effect of which is:
1. To prohibit the driving of vehicles in:
• Lorrimore avenue - for its entirety
• St Georges Terrace - from Ford hill to Balmoral Avenue
• Sturdee Road - from St Levan Road to Fullerton Road
• Fisher Road - northbound at the junction of St Georges Terrace
• Ganges Road - northbound at the junction of St Georges Terrace
• Glenmore Avenue - for its entirety
• Craigmore Avenue - from St Levan Road to St Georges Terrace
• Welsford Avenue - for its entirety
• Balmoral Avenue - for its entirety
2. To prohibit the parking, waiting, loading & unloading of vehicles in:
• Lorrimore avenue - for its entirety
• St Georges Terrace - for its entirety
• St Levan Road - from Ryder Road to Sturdee Road Lane
• Glenmore Avenue - for its entirety
• Craigmore Avenue - from St Levan Road to St Georges Terrace
• Welsford Avenue - for its entirety
• Balmoral Avenue - for its entirety
The prohibition of driving, parking, waiting, loading, unloading will be in operation on the days and during the hours that the appropriate traffic signs are displayed. The Order shall come into force on 5th January 2026 and shall continue in force for a maximum of 18 months
It is anticipated that the phased gas works will commence on the 5th January 2026 until 22nd May 2026 24hrs
